Chelsea v Leeds: The Blues are swinging along in fine form at the moment, pushing themselves into the title race.

In their last league fixture, they played out a draw with Tottenham to finish the weekend in third place in the table.

Chelsea are W2 D2 L1 at the Bridge this season and each of the failures to win happened against teams currently in the top six.

Chelsea are the 1/2 odds-on favourites with Boylesports for the win in this one.

It has been an average of over 2 goals per game from them in their home fixtures, so they will be expected to have the firepower to bring down Leeds.

Leeds picked up a 1-0 win away at Everton in their last league game.

They are big 5/1 underdogs to pull one off at Chelsea on the weekend.

That has been just their second win in their last even league games as they have found the going a little tougher.

That win at Goodison Park moved Leeds on to a W3 L2 record away from home this season in the top flight.

In each of their away wins they have kept a clean sheet. In each of their road losses, they have conceded exactly four goals.

Free Acca Betting Tip: West Ham v Man Utd

There should be a good battle in London as West Ham play host to Manchester United on the weekend.

The Hammers are on the up at the moment as they have won their last three games.

That sequence includes back to back home wins.

In last season’s corresponding fixture, the Irons took a 2-0 win over Manchester United.

West Ham, therefore, have won their last two league home games against United and are unbeaten in three.

So they do warrant a look for our daily acca tips here at 13/5 with Boylesports.

Manchester United have discovered a little bit of form to climb up the table with.

It has been three wins on the spin for them, but there have been tight squeezes for them.

They only edged the struggling West Brom 1-0 at Old Trafford and had to fight back from 2-0 down against Southampton to bag a win in their last fixture.

Manchester United are evens to win on Saturday.

There are vulnerabilities there, but we expect them to get on the scoresheet and don’t see them getting over the line.

Norwich v Sheffield Wednesday: Daily Free Acca Tips on Online Betting

It’s off to the Championship next for our best free daily acca tips to look at Norwich v Sheffield Wednesday.

The Canaries had a great run of unbeaten form snapped in midweek as they lost against Luton in a surprise result.

But they are still sitting in second place in the table with a W8 D4 L3 record.

The Canaries have taken a W3 D3 L1 record at Carrow Road and they are the 5/6 favourites to down Sheffield Wednesday on Saturday.

Norwich are W2 D2 in their last four home games against the Owls.

It is a five-match unbeaten streak of home form that Norwich hold on to currently in the Championship.

Sheffield Wednesday have still not managed to claw their way out of the relegation zone yet.

But they are scrapping along having drawn four of their last five and have only lost one of their last six (W1 D4 L1).

Sheffield Wednesday are big 15/4 underdogs for the win on Saturday.

It has only been the 8 goals in total that the Owls have managed totally in this season’s Championship, but they have been hard to break down.

We see them putting up a bit of resistance but not coming away with three points.

Online Betting Football Tip: Stoke v Middlesbrough

There were three points for Stoke in midweek with a success at Wycombe to keep the Potters in touch with the top six.

It has been a W3 D1 L1 record from Stoke in their last five games now and the loss in that sequence happened against Norwich.

Stoke have posted a W3 D2 L2 record at home this season winning three of their last four there.

It has been a decent average of 1.8 goals per home game that Stoke have come up with.

The two losses that they have suffered at home have been against sides currently in the top five.

They are at 6/4 to pick up a home success in this fixture.

Middlesbrough won at Stoke last season, a 2-0 result. But Boro currently remain in patchy form.

They have alternated between a loss and a win in their last four league fixtures.

It is the way of Boro that needs the closest examination.

They are only W1 D4 L2 on the road and have failed to score in two of their last three road games.

We think that Stoke take them.
